Best Practices for JavaScript Debugging
Debugging JavaScript can often be a challenging task, but with the right practices, you can streamline the process significantly. Here are some best practices for effective JavaScript debugging that will help you identify and fix issues quickly and efficiently.
1. Use Console.log Wisely
One of the simplest yet most effective tools for debugging in JavaScript is the console.log() method. Use it to output variable values and trace the flow of your code. Make sure to add descriptive messages to your logs to make them more informative.
2. Utilize Browser Developer Tools
Modern browsers come with built-in developer tools that allow you to inspect elements, monitor network activity, and debug JavaScript. Use the Sources tab to set breakpoints in your code, allowing you to pause execution and examine the current state of your application.
3. Leverage Breakpoints
Setting breakpoints in your code can significantly enhance your debugging process. Breakpoints allow you to stop execution at a specific line of code and inspect variable values at that point. This can help you identify where things are going wrong.
4. Understand Scopes and Closures
JavaScript's function scope and closures can sometimes lead to unexpected behavior. Be aware of how variables are scoped within functions and how closures maintain references to variables. Understanding these concepts can help you track down bugs related to variable scope.
5. Use Try-Catch for Error Handling
Utilizing try-catch blocks is an excellent way to handle potential errors gracefully. By wrapping potentially problematic code in a try-catch block, you can catch exceptions and log them, providing insight into what went wrong without crashing your application.
6. Validate Input and Output
Always validate the inputs your functions receive and the outputs they produce. Incorrect inputs often lead to bugs, so add checks to ensure that the data you are working with is valid. This can help prevent runtime errors and improve overall code stability.
7. Use Debugging Libraries
Consider using external libraries such as Redux DevTools or React Developer Tools for React applications. These tools can provide powerful debugging features tailored to specific frameworks, making it easier to track state changes and application flows.
8. Review Your Code with Others
Sometimes a fresh set of eyes can catch problems that you might have overlooked. Conduct code reviews with peers to identify potential areas of concern and improve code quality through collaborative debugging efforts.
9. Keep Your Code Organized
Organized code is easier to debug. Use modular programming practices, such as breaking code into smaller functions, to improve readability and maintainability. Well-structured code will help you quickly locate issues when they arise.
10. Document Your Debugging Process
Finally, document the bugs you encounter and their solutions. Keeping a record will not only help you remember how to fix similar issues in the future but will also assist other developers who may face the same challenge.
